The Dubai Training Reality
Why recovery is harder here
Dubai has one of the most active fitness cultures in the world. CrossFit boxes, padel courts, cycling groups, functional training studios and high-performance gyms are packed year-round. Many Dubai residents train 4–6 times per week — often pushing intensity levels that would be considered elite in other cities.
But the environment creates specific recovery challenges that don't exist in cooler climates. Year-round heat means higher core body temperature during training, greater fluid loss, and a physiological stress load that compounds the muscular damage from exercise itself. Vitamin D levels — paradoxically — are often low despite constant sunshine, because most residents spend the majority of their time indoors in air conditioning. The combination of intense training, heat stress and lifestyle factors means that recovery in Dubai is genuinely harder than it looks from the outside.

The Science
What red light therapy actually does to muscle tissue
When you train hard, muscle fibres sustain microscopic damage — controlled tears that, when repaired, result in stronger, more adapted tissue. The quality and speed of this repair cycle determines how quickly you can train again and how well you perform in the next session.
The repair process is driven by mitochondria — the cellular structures that produce ATP, the energy currency that powers all biological repair. Near-infrared light in the 830–850nm range is absorbed directly by mitochondrial photoreceptors, triggering a measurable increase in ATP production and a reduction in the oxidative stress that slows repair.
The result, confirmed across 14+ controlled clinical trials, is faster muscle fibre repair, reduced inflammation, lower DOMS severity and improved performance in subsequent sessions.
